September 2025 (Month: 2025-09) focused on strengthening upgrade readiness and cloud integration in virt-s1/os-tests to deliver sustainable business value. Key features delivered include RHEL upgrade readiness improvements (preconfiguring network settings, removing legacy drivers, and adding NM migration support) and GCP platform integration enhancements (bare metal scheduling, multiple ADC-based authentication methods, and removal of the default Google project to enforce explicit project selection). These changes enhance upgrade reliability, cloud workload placement, and governance to reduce misconfig risks. No high-severity bugs were recorded in the provided data. Technologies demonstrated include Leapp-based upgrade workflows, NetworkManager/NM migrations, and GCP API authentication and bare metal integration. January 2025 performance summary for virt-s1/os-tests: Expanded cloud image compatibility, confidential computing on GCP, and reliability improvements in the test suite. Key outcomes include broader image format support (GCE, VHD) with compliant AMI naming, standardized boot disk logging and VMDK naming, SEV/SEV-SNP/TDX support with test/config updates, and enhanced TPM/dmesg validations for better failure diagnostics.
